In this paper, a new scalable audio codec is described that has the characteristics of low complexity and fine-step granule scalability. For this purpose, the proposed scheme has the same coding scheme for all layers. The proposed algorithm does not have the core coding part for low bit-rate application and can be implemented with 1 kbps enhancement step size with bit-sliced coding method. The result will be demonstrated at presentation which handle from 16 to 64 kbps case with 8 kbps enhancement step size: 16-24-32-40-48-56-64 kbps.
